‘We Are Not Under Probe’
The Onne Oil and Gas Free Zone Authority, says it is not under probe for corrupt practices by the Federal Ministry of Trade and Investment.
The Acting Managing Director of the Authority, Mr. Peter Ibeh who said this during a press briefing at the Authority’s office, Onne denied allegation that the authority spent N32.8 million for the purchase of items for Abuja office use.
Mr. Ibeh said that the sum of N21.5million was spent by the free zone authority in respect of the furnishing of its Abuja office and attributed the misinformation to the activities of one of the authority’s managers who was suspended for failing to produce his original certificates.
Also speaking, the manager in charge of Legal Department OGFZA, Mr Momoh Sani Shuaibu said that all purchasing contracts and other transactions carried out by the Free Zone Authority had the due approval of not only the ministry, but the Tenders Board and Due Process Office.
Also speaking, the Head of Finance and Accounts, Mr. Adekunle Ajayi said that contracts executed by the management has the approval of the Ministerial Tenders Board, stressing that in line with the one process office contracts were always advertised for competitive bidding.
